Odor Reduction

Antimicrobial fabrics greatly reduce odor by preventing the growth of bacteria and fungi. When you wear traditional fabrics, sweat and natural body oils create a breeding ground for microbes. These microbes, flourishing in warm, moist environments, produce unpleasant odors.

However, antimicrobial fabrics leverage advanced fabric technology to counteract this problem. Utilizing cutting-edge innovations, these fabrics are imbued with agents that inhibit microbial activity. This means the bacteria and fungi don't get the chance to multiply and produce those foul smells.

Imagine your workouts or long days at the office without worrying about unsavory odors clinging to your clothes. It's a game-changer. You might wonder how effective these fabrics are in the long run. The key lies in their microbial resistance.

Unlike traditional fabrics that may temporarily mask odors, antimicrobial fabrics provide a more permanent solution. They maintain their resistance even after multiple washes, ensuring you stay fresh and odor-free.

Healthcare Applications

In healthcare settings, antimicrobial fabrics play an essential role in reducing infection rates and maintaining sterile environments. You'll find these advanced materials integrated into surgical gowns and patient bedding, where they help limit the spread of harmful pathogens.

Surgical gowns made from antimicrobial fabrics provide an additional layer of protection for both the patient and the medical staff. By inhibiting bacterial growth, these gowns reduce the risk of post-operative infections, ensuring better outcomes.

Patient bedding, too, benefits significantly from these textiles. Hospital beds are high-contact surfaces prone to contamination. Antimicrobial linens guarantee that bacteria and viruses don't thrive, making the environment safer for patients who are already vulnerable. This is particularly important in intensive care units and surgical recovery areas, where the risk of infection is highest.

Environmental Impact

The environmental impact of antimicrobial fabrics raises significant concerns about their long-term sustainability and ecological footprint. While these fabrics offer notable benefits, it's important to examine how they align with eco-friendly practices and their overall sustainability impact.

It's necessary to be aware of several key points to fully understand the environmental implications:

  1. Sustainability Impact: Antimicrobial fabrics often involve treatments that may contain chemicals harmful to the environment. It's crucial to opt for fabrics treated with natural or less harmful agents to mitigate this issue.
  2. Eco-Friendly Practices: Manufacturers are increasingly adopting eco-friendly practices in the production of antimicrobial fabrics. Make sure to choose products from companies committed to reducing their carbon footprint and following sustainable manufacturing processes.
  3. Recycling Potential: Not all antimicrobial fabrics are created equal when it comes to recycling. Look for materials that can be easily recycled, thereby contributing to waste reduction and promoting a circular economy.
  4. Waste Reduction: Antimicrobial fabrics can lead to less frequent washing and longer product life, which reduces water and energy use. This indirectly contributes to waste reduction and lessens the environmental burden.
